Transaction ed3a34b903ba19fcc83616e16b9ae272ce90336c485e2904fc589fda1b7c1a19
1 Input
1 Output
-
ed3a34b903ba19fcc83616e16b9ae272ce90336c485e2904fc589fda1b7c1a19:0
- value
- 613875688
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 73f499f4cd8aa577ef2231d3cd2578e5ec2de843 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Ba7jGGBwMCAdD8evBS8Uwh19xzLkNWt6o